The Black Hoof

Editorial Review

Lots of meat. Variety of cheese. Plenty of drink. One cutting board will never be like the other. Local hipsters, avid foodies, and visiting celebrities looking to see what all the fuss is about line up to sample Grant Van Grameran's groundbreaking cuisine. Decor is low key (read: nothing is on the walls) minus the variety of butcher knives adjacent to open kitchen. Service is friendly and requests are customized and personalized. That cocktail that's not on the minimal menu will be made for you without even asking. The headquarters of Va Grameran and partner Jen Agg's burgeoning empire.
